## Recovery: Sweeper-locked accounts (Cindervale)

Heads up: the orphaned-resource sweeper on Cindervale sometimes flags an account mid-recovery and quarantines its buckets before the owner can re-verify. It's overly eager, not malicious — the sweeper treats any account without a login in 90 days as orphaned, even if recovery is in flight. To pause the sweeper for a single tenant, open the quarantine console and release the hold. The console accepts the recovery passphrase shown just below.

unlock words, bahop-fawef: novmir-druwyn-soriel-rusdor-kasion

## Step 4: Point your plugin at the new Tilehoard prefetcher

Almost there! Tilehoard v3 replaces the old polling prefetcher with an event-driven one, so plugins no longer register fetch intervals — drop those calls entirely. Instead, subscribe to viewport events and let Tilehoard batch your tile requests. To test locally, run the prefetcher with the following configuration values.

service settings:
PRAIX_LOG_LEVEL=error
PRAIX_METRICS_HOST=metrics.praix.qorvelcorp.corp
PRAIX_POOL_SIZE=16

ALERT: Parityhawk rate-parity checker is returning stale comparisons for properties synced via third-party plugins. Discrepancy flags raised in the last 6 hours may be false positives. Plugin authors should pause automated repricing actions until cleared. Verification steps and the current incident status for plugin integrations are posted on this page.

wiki page, tageg-kagap: https://rundeck.tolvaqhq.example/settings/merge_requests/issue/build/ticket/run/ticket/b43dbdf7e2bdd679fb7f087a